Modification of Statutes. Any references, express or implied, to statutes or statutory provisions shall be construed as references to those statutes or provisions as respectively amended or re-enacted or as their application is modified from time to time by other provisions (whether before or after the date hereof) and shall include any statutes or provisions of which they are re-enactments (whether with or without modification) and any orders, regulations, instruments or other subordinate legislation under the relevant statute or statutory provision. References to sections of consolidating legislation shall wherever necessary or appropriate in the context be construed as including references to the sections of the previous legislation from which the consolidating legislation has been prepared.
Modification of Statutes. Any reference in this Agreement to a statutory provision shall include that provision and any regulations made in pursuance thereof as from time to time modified or re-enacted, whether before or after the date of this Agreement, so far as such modification or re-enactment applies or is capable of applying to any transactions entered into and (so far as liability thereunder may exist or can arise) shall include also any past statutory provision or regulation (as from time to time modified or re-enacted) which such provision or regulation has directly or indirectly replaced.
